đ Meet Our Class Leaders
Crayg Wellbeloved
Crayg has been performing in musicals since the age of 11. After studying Performing Arts at Chester University, he moved to Telford and joined SMTC, where he has played numerous lead roles including Judas in Jesus Christ Superstar, Bernadette in Priscilla Queen of the Desert, Ariel in Return to the Forbidden Planet, Motel in Fiddler on the Roof, Eddie in Sister Act, Willie Lopez in Ghost and Gabe Brown in School of Rock.
Crayg also directed SMTCâs 5â production of Beautiful The Carole King Musical and continues to perform with the company while leading our Mini SMTC classes with energy, expertise and passion for nurturing young talent.
Megan Austin
Fresh from choreographing Spamalot, Megan brings professional experience and infectious enthusiasm to our sessions. She trained at The Hammond School from ages 13 to 16 before gaining early entry to Bird College, where she completed her Level 6 Diploma in Musical Theatre at just 18.
Her professional credits include ensemble and first cover Wicked Queen in Snow White pantomime. Megan has choreographed numerous dance showcases, musicals and wedding dances, and continues to teach Mini SMTC while training in aerial skills and fitness.
Together, Crayg and Megan supported by our amazing class assistant Jess Foxall create a supportive, inspiring environment where every child can find their voice, build confidence and have fun on stage. đ
